
Since being founded by Terry Looney in 1995, STX has evolved to become a very diverse supplier of a wide range of products and services. STX offers Intelligent Solutions™ to a broad range of clients.
Services range from Intelligent Lab Design to Professional Project Management. Product lines provide solutions for the modern laboratory across the full spectrum of disciplines and applications.
Our business is really quite simple. We just try to treat our clients right and follow the roadmap of doing each job well.
Marketing 101 - Find a need and fill it... we found two!
STX’s business has been developed around two market needs we identified as being critical.
First, we found that the market lacked a strong mid-Atlantic partner for the distribution of analytical instrumentation. We knew that with our industry wide knowledge and relationships and our local presence we could fill that need.
Second, with over 25 years in the lab industry, we saw that far too many labs were being built without sufficient consideration begin given to their applications. There seemed to be a default to a one-size-fits-all approach and too little attention to detail. For that, we knew there was a better way... and we set out to find a way to deliver it. We believe that our model of applications driven “Intelligent Lab Design” is the answer.
